These are good, time-tested methods. Asking specific students questions usually gets the attention or conveys the message to remain focused. Whenever I have to stop and ask questions to reengage, I also have the specific students stay after for a chat about my expectations and their desires for learning the material. For me, it's important to try to be assertive without being punitive.
